2017-06-21 70 views
2

我寫了一個Chrome擴展,它使用本地存儲。以編程方式刷新Chrome策略?

當我在瀏覽器中打開chrome://policy/時,我可以根據其ID查看擴展的數據,但是,當我在註冊表中手動更改值時,它不會自動更新。相反,我必須點擊「重新加載策略」按鈕。

我的擴展使用這些數據,必須更新。 如何從我的代碼刷新Chrome策略? (好像用戶將點擊「重新加載政策」按鈕。)

謝謝!

enter image description here

+1

我看到'鉻.send(「reloadPolicies」)'在頁面代碼中,它只在內置的chrome://頁面上可用,它不在API中公開。所以唯一的辦法就是用'--extensions-on-chrome-urls'命令行開關在本地運行chrome,並在「chrome:// policy」頁面注入/聲明一個內容腳本(注意,你可以打開它作爲固定不活動標籤)。 – wOxxOm

回答

0

對於Windows,即使你只是管理在註冊表中,而不是通過GPO的信息,則強制更新反映在Chrome中:

gpupdate /force